GENFIT: HALF-YEAR REPORT OF LIQUIDITY CONTRACT WITH CIC

Lille (France), Cambridge (Massachusetts, United States), January 12, 2018 - GENFIT (Euronext: GNFT - ISIN: FR0004163111), a biopharmaceutical company at the forefront of developing therapeutic and diagnostic solutions in metabolic and inflammatory diseases, that notably affect the liver or the gastrointestinal system, today announces the half-year report of its liquidity contract with CIC.

Under the liquidity contract granted to CIC by GENFIT, the following resources were in the liquidity account as at Decembrer 31, 2017:

  • 6,586 shares
     
  • €267,012.36 in cash.

At the half-year report as at June 30, 2017, the following resources were available in the liquidity account:

  • 3,753 shares
     
  • €254,255.05 in cash

Since the last communication on the half year position of the liquidity contract at June 30, 2017, GENFIT increased the amount allocated to the contract on December 8, 2017 by €250,000.

About GENFIT

GENFIT is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the discovery and development of drug candidates in areas of high unmet medical needs corresponding to a lack of suitable treatment and an increasing number of patients worldwide. GENFIT's R&D efforts are focused on bringing new medicines to market for patients with metabolic, inflammatory, autoimmune and fibrotic diseases, that affect the liver (such as NASH - Nonalcoholic steatohepatitis) and more generally the gastro-intestinal arena. GENFIT's approach combines novel treatments and biomarkers. Its lead proprietary compound, elafibranor, is currently in a Phase 3 study. With facilities in Lille and Paris, France, and Cambridge, MA (USA), the Company has approximately 130 employees. GENFIT is a public company listed in compartment B of Euronext's regulated market in Paris (Euronext: GNFT - ISIN: FR0004163111). www.genfit.com
